数据库
首页 > 数据库> > python-在MySQL和Tornado之间创建连接

python-在MySQL和Tornado之间创建连接

作者:互联网

我正在尝试启动并运行Python和Tornado环境.

到目前为止,我已经能够执行Python脚本,并且现在我正试图也能够利用数据库.

据我了解,Tornado有一个MySQL包装器,到目前为止,我已经安装了XAMPP,我想继续使用PhpMyAdmin作为MySQL的GUI.

我的问题是如何在MySQL和Tornado之间建立连接?

这样,当您使用连接命令时,Tornado将连接到正确的MySQL安装和数据库,我当然是用PhpMyAdmin创建的?

解决方法:

从龙卷风的documentation

db = database.Connection("localhost", "mydatabase")

实例化连接(在此示例中为db)后,就可以在服务器的生命周期内重用它.

如果您需要在龙卷风服务器运行时动态更改它,则必须将龙卷风“监听”到特定的url_pattern,由适当的web.RequestHandler处理,该web.RequestHandler接收MYSQL连接参数(主机,数据库)作为(GET或POST)参数. ,用户等.)并创建新的数据库连接.

编辑

在新版本的龙卷风(> = 3.0)中,tornado.database模块已被删除.现在可以单独购买torndb.

标签:python-2-7,tornado,python,mysql
来源: https://codeday.me/bug/20191202/2085471.html